UbixOS  2.0
kprintf.h File Reference
#include <sys/types.h>
#include <stdarg.h>
Include dependency graph for kprintf.h:

Go to the source code of this file.

Macros

#define MAXNBUF   512
 

Functions

int kprintf (const char *,...)
 
int kvprintf (char const *fmt, void(*func)(int, void *), void *arg, int radix, va_list ap)
 
int ogPrintf (char *)
 
int sprintf (char *buf, const char *fmt,...)
 

Variables

int ogprintOff
 
int printOff
 

Macro Definition Documentation

◆ MAXNBUF

#define MAXNBUF   512

Definition at line 35 of file kprintf.h.

Function Documentation

◆ kprintf()

int kprintf ( const char *  ,
  ... 
)

◆ kvprintf()

int kvprintf ( char const fmt,
void(*)(int, void *)  func,
void *  arg,
int  radix,
va_list  ap 
)

Definition at line 315 of file kprintf.c.

References MAXNBUF, NULL, PCHAR, uu::q, and va_arg.

Referenced by kprintf(), and sprintf().

◆ ogPrintf()

int ogPrintf ( char *  )

Definition at line 40 of file ogprintf.cc.

References vitalsStruct::font, vitalsStruct::screen, and systemVitals.

Referenced by kprintf().

◆ sprintf()

int sprintf ( char *  buf,
const char *  fmt,
  ... 
)

Variable Documentation

◆ ogprintOff

int ogprintOff

Definition at line 257 of file kprintf.c.

Referenced by kprintf(), sdeThread(), and systemTask().

◆ printOff

int printOff

Definition at line 256 of file kprintf.c.

Referenced by kprintf(), sdeThread(), ogDisplay_UbixOS::SetMode(), and systemTask().